#736c73 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#736c73 is composed of 45.1% red, 42.4% green and 45.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 6.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 54.9% black. It has a hue angle of 300 degrees, a saturation of 3.1% and a lightness of 43.7%. #736c73 color hex could be obtained by blending #e6d8e6 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666666.

Shades and Tints of #736c73

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040404 is the darkest color, while #f9f9f9 is the lightest one.
